Lightyear Overview for Kenya
Lightyear is a European investment platform founded in 2020 in Tallinn, Estonia, with a mission to make global investing affordable and accessible. It has gained popularity across the UK and Europe and is now being adopted by Kenya traders looking for a simple way to invest in US stocks and ETFs. Unlike traditional forex brokers, Lightyear does not offer currency pairs, CFDs on gold or oil, or MetaTrader platforms. Instead, it provides zero-commission trading on thousands of listed US and European shares and exchange-traded funds, with a unique feature of fractional shares that lets Kenyan investors start with as little as $1 (about KES 130). For Kenya traders, the main appeal is the low entry point and the platform's mobile-first design, which suits the local mobile data environment. It also supports M-Pesa deposits via local on-ramps, making it one of the few regulated international brokers that sit comfortably within Kenya's mobile money ecosystem. The company is backed by recognised investors such as Lightspeed and had over 400,000 users across its markets as of 2025, indicating a credible and growing platform. While it is not regulated by the Kenyan CMA, its FCA and EFSA oversight provides a layer of international credibility. Kenyan traders who want to diversify their savings into US equities without converting large sums will find Lightyear's onboarding fast, transparent, and localised for emerging markets.

Islamic Account — Kenya Muslim Traders
Lightyear does not provide an Islamic or swap-free account. Since the platform focuses on real shares and ETFs rather than leveraged CFD contracts, the concept of overnight swap fees does not directly apply to standard cash accounts. However, Muslim traders in Kenya who want to keep their investments sharia-compliant still face a challenge, because Lightyear includes companies and ETFs that may involve interest-based debt, and there is no halal screening tool on the platform. Some Kenyan Islamic investors may choose to manually build a portfolio of companies that avoid riba (interest) and avoid leveraged products. To apply for any sharia-based customisation, you would need to contact support, but currently, no official Islamic account exists. Therefore, conservative Muslim traders may prefer brokers like Exness or FBS that offer separate Islamic accounts for forex trading.

Common Mistakes Kenya Traders Make with Lightyear
- Mistake: Assuming Lightyear is a forex broker — it is not; Kenyan traders expecting MT4, currency pairs, gold, or oil will be disappointed.
- Using M-Pesa for very small deposits repeatedly — the conversion fees can add up, so combine funds and deposit in larger amounts.
- Forgetting that Lightyear is not CMA-regulated in Kenya, so you need to keep supporting documents and follow their terms carefully.

Final Verdict — Is Lightyear Worth It for Kenya Traders?
3.7/5
★★★★★
Lightyear is a credible and cost-effective platform for Kenya traders who want to invest in global stocks and ETFs through a simple, mobile-friendly app. With a minimum deposit of $1 and support for M-Pesa and USDT, it removes many of the barriers that have kept Kenyans out of international markets. However, it is not a forex or CFD broker, and its lack of CMA regulation means you are relying on European protection only. For long-term investors, buy-and-hold savers, or anyone looking to dollar-cost average into the S&P 500 from Kenya, Lightyear is genuinely worth using. For short-term FX scalpers or commodity traders, it offers nothing relevant. Overall, we recommend Lightyear with a 3.7-star rating — a good broker for the right kind of Kenyan trader, but not a universal solution.
